Is it okay to get pregnant while having crohn's disease?

Depends: Your general health and the medications you are taking are important in predicting the safety of pregnancy. Some of the medications for crohn's disease are ok in pregnancy and other increase risk of defects. Some women get better during pregnancy and other do much worse. Talk with your GI doctor and your ob.
